Original Piña Colada Recipe

The original recipe of the famous tropical drink, the first Piña Colada cocktail was created at the Caribe Hilton in Puerto Rico and is made with silver rum, coconut cream and fresh pineapple juice.

Ingredients

  • 8 ounces silver rum such as Don Q, or gold rum
  • 4 ounces coconut cream
  • 4 ounces heavy cream
  • 24 ounces pineapple juice or crushed pineapple, fresh
  • 2 cups ice
  • cocktail cherries optional garnishes
  • cocktail umbrellas optional garnishes

Instructions

  1. Place all ingredients in a high speed blender and puree until smooth before pouring in to four glasses. Alternatively, you can also use a cocktail shaker and serve over the rocks.

Notes

  • In Puerto Rico they love using silver or gold Don Q rum. This first version was actually shaken instead of blended because blenders didn’t yet exist.
